The word 'disenchant' is correct and usable in written English.
It is a verb that means to cause someone to lose enthusiasm or belief in something. For example, "The unfulfilled promises of the venture capitalist quickly disenchanted the other investors".

During World War II the philosophers Max Horkheimer and Theodor Adorno drew on Weber to point out that science's attempts to disenchant the world resulted only in a kind of return of the repressed: the irrationality that had been squelched by enlightened reason returned in the form of violence and barbarism.

Later political theorists and philosophers such as Jane Bennett and Charles Taylor sought to question the very premises of Weber's thesis that science serves only to disenchant the world and dispel spiritual feeling.
